Its … WebPermacaths provide long-term central venous access for treatments which require high flow rates, such as dialysis or plasmapheresis. How it’s done: An interventional radiologist uses ultrasound to access the target vein, most commonly the internal jugular vein in the neck. slowhttptest 安装
